## Introduction

This is source code for the Internet Connectome Project, which has the goal of
mapping the networks delays throughout the Internet via crowdsourcing.

The goal of the survey was to map the topology of the Internet as well as measure,
as accurately as possible, the latency between any two end points of the Internet
where users could be. The topology is surveyed using the traceroute tool.
The latency is estimated using two types of pings.
The first ping method is the classical ping that uses the ICMP protocol to estimate
the round-trip time between two computers. The second ping method
is the non-traditional TCP ping that uses the TCP protocol to estimate the time
it takes to establish a TCP connection between the local host and the remote destination.

Volunteers could participate to the survey by going to our Internet survey web page
and launching a Java applet. The applet probes the topology of the Internet and
estimates the latency to a number of remote destinations as determined by our survey server.
The survey server determines which remote hosts will be probed by the volunteers
in order to ensure a good coverage of the Internet as well as reliable latency measures.
